Eagle Creek Sartell Hydro, LLC; Notice of Intent To Prepare an 
Environmental Assessment

    On February 28, 2023, Eagle Creek Sartell Hydro, LLC filed a 
relicense application for the 8.925-megawatt Sartell Hydroelectric 
Project No. 8315 (project). The project is located on the Mississippi 
River in Stearns and Benton Counties, Minnesota.
    In accordance with the Commission's regulations, on February 12, 
2026, Commission staff issued a notice that the project was ready for 
environmental analysis (REA notice). Based on the information in the 
record, including comments filed on the REA Notice, staff does not 
anticipate that licensing the project would constitute a major federal 
action significantly affecting the quality of the human environment. 
Therefore, staff intends to prepare an environmental assessment (EA) on 
the application to relicense the project.\1\

    The EA will be issued and circulated for review by all interested 
parties. All comments filed on the EA will be analyzed by staff and 
considered in the Commission's final licensing decision.
